Through useful, seamless, affordable … Webb10 nov. 2024 · MFS Africa recently signed an agreement to acquire Baxi, a leading super-agent in Nigeria, and plans to build Baxi into a key node, allowing regional payments into and from Nigeria. Continuing on its current growth trajectory, MFS Africa said it intends to additional regional offices in key African markets, as well as in the USA and China.

Webb10 dec. 2024 · Safaricom’s Mpesa, founded in March 2007, is the behemoth everyone knows thanks to their 99% share of the mobile money market in Kenya. Across seven countries, it has over 430,000 agents. Over 41 million customers performed 12 billion transactions in 2024.
